Job description

Company Overview

Imagine a piloted air taxi that takes off vertically, then quietly carries you and your fellow passengers over the congested city streets below, enabling you to spend more time with the people and places that matter most. Since 2009, our team has worked steadily to make this dream a reality. We’ve designed and tested many generations of prototype aircraft capable of serving in a network of electric air taxis. We’re looking for talented, committed individuals to join our team as we push onward toward certifying the Joby aircraft, scaling our manufacturing, and launching our initial commercial service.

Overview

Joby Aviation is seeking a highly organized, passionate individual to join our quality engineering team. As part of this team, you will oversee the quality aspects of flight and propulsion control systems for VTOL electric aircraft. This Quality Engineering position will help baseline the company’s design efforts and pave the way to production. The Joby Aviation team is made up of extremely talented, hardworking, proactive, and hands-on individuals, operating in a very fast-paced and rewarding environment. We are looking to expand this team with like-minded individuals looking to make a mark in the transportation industry.

Responsibilities
  • Support the development, verification and manufacture of products using Advanced Production Quality Planning (APQP), Continuous Improvement and Statistical Process Control techniques
  • Perform design review activities including inspectability, consistency, adequacy, accuracy, and conformance to requirements and provide recommendations for improvement
  • Develop and manage data and metrics using data visualization tools to report and provide information with recommendations for product/process improvements and reduce cost of poor quality
  • Perform product quality and quality management system reviews to assure compliance with drawings, work instructions and internal ISO9001/AS9100 and regulatory requirements
  • Analyze product and process failures to ensure effective root cause analysis and implementation of corrective and preventive actions internally
  • Understand risk and risk management as an essential part of the quality engineering work scope
  • Represent Quality on the Material Review Board (MRB) and Engineering Change Actions
  • Responsible for participating in continual improvement activities to enhance the quality system, such as 5S, Kaizen lean methods, etc
  • Interface with Engineering, Manufacturing and Operations to ensure transfer to Production of new products are in accordance with approved data
  • Responsible for performing job duties in a manner consistent with established Joby Policies and Procedures.
  • Works under general direction. Independently determines and develops approach to solutions. Work is reviewed upon completion for adequacy in meeting objectives.
  • Frequent inter-organizational and outside company contacts.
Required
  • Bachelor's degree in engineering, technology, or related field
  • Minimum 3 years experience in a Quality/Manufacturing Engineering role supporting a manufacturing environment
  • Understanding of mechanical systems and inspection processes including in-process inspection and dimensional inspection
  • Fundamental understanding of quality philosophies, principles, systems, methods, and tools
  • Understanding of ISO9001, AS9100, or TS16949 Quality Management System
  • Strong interpersonal and communication skills including writing skills
Desired
  • Experience in the aviation industry
  • Knowledge of FAA regulatory requirements
  • Six Sigma Lean Manufacturing and Green or Black Belt certification
  • ASQ Certified Quality Engineer
  • Familiarity with complex Geometric Dimensioning and Tolerancing
  • Knowledge of AS9102 first article inspection process
Additional Information

Compensation at Joby is a combination of base pay and Restricted Stock Units (RSUs). The target base pay for this position is $106,700 - $186,000 per year. The compensation package will be determined by job-related knowledge, skills, and experience.Joby also offers a comprehensive benefits package, including paid time off, healthcare benefits, a 401(k) plan with a company match, an employee stock purchase plan (ESPP), short-term and long-term disability coverage, life insurance, and more.
